For mining Bitcoin just CPU or GPU's: None. Perhaps read this pinned msg as to why... Mainly point-3 Now as for running cgminer as a front end to say Sidehack's newest USB stick miners -- use Linux. I initially ran that stick under Win10 and later moved it to a RasPi3B: at same clock speed using Raspian gave a 10% increase in hash rate and allowed the stick be remain stable almost 150MHz faster than it did under Winbloze.

BFGMiner is more or less the same as CGMiner. The only major difference is that it doesn't focus on GPUs like CGMiner but instead it is designed specifically for ASICs. Wrong. The 'cg' originally stood for CPU GPU but code for using those was removed long long ago by -ck and Kano back when they still collaborated. While cgminer still does support some FPGA's, it has been primarily geared for ASICS for many many years now.

cgminer and bfgminer have not been updated in years
ck stopped developing cgminer some years ago, but kano continued developing it. For example, the GekkoScience Compac F was released in 2021, and support for it was added in cgminer by kano. You can see that there's also recent activity in that repo: https://github.com/kanoi/cgminerbfgminer doesn't seem to be as active, but still there are some changes from last year: https://github.com/luke-jr/bfgminer
